Output 4faeeca652ea626a8a2cc1477d4caf908a20f7e8fbae1ff21428c7b54beaf7e4:14

value
102895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8421fceb8a2ec161b1a713860ad74335bd420849 OP_EQUAL
address
3DjfqPd6z849J4r8AJDsLHZyhHKqqoxzeQ
transaction
4faeeca652ea626a8a2cc1477d4caf908a20f7e8fbae1ff21428c7b54beaf7e4
spent
true